摘要
On the basis of our accumulated data for iron films, experimental comment on the tangent rule, which is a functional relation between the incidence angle αI of obliquely deposited films and the inclination angle αc, of columns, is presented. The αc strongly depends on the deposition parameters, such as substrate temperature Ts, deposition rate R, or the vapour beam density Rv and pressure ρ during deposition. The ranges of parameters where the tangent rule is obeyed are very narrow and very limited.
